It's official. Dee just posted on the HBS blog that they are at the half-way mark with the interview invitation process.
It looks as if we are roughly halfway through the invitation process. We will continue to issue invitations up to and including the notification date, which is January 16, 2008.
Why do the interview invitations slow down from this point on?
In the beginning of each round, all of our resources are deployed to reading applications. Once we begin the actual interviewing (interviews began on November 5) we cannot read at the same pace — hence the slowing down of the invitation rate.
To be clear, there is no order or pattern to which applications are read first.
We hope that bulletins like this are helpful and we sincerely appreciate your patience in this process.
